Join our Mechanic 101 Course!
This course will teach you the basics of bicycle maintenance and repair. Topic will include:
Tire & TubesWheel ServiceBrakes and ShiftingBearing Systemsand more!Attendees will receive 10% off tool purchases (but please be aware that there are bike supply shortages, so your order might take a bit to restock)
*This course is for ages 16 and up*
Calendar:
June 9 - ABC’s and PBC Standards June 15 - Tubes & TiresJune 22 Hub ServiceJune 29 - Wheel Truing July 6 - Brakes July 13 - Shifting Smoothly July 20 - Chain July 27 - Bottom Bracket August 3 - Headset August 10 - Hydraulic Disc Brakes and Suspension Set Up
Bicycle Collective has made bikes and bike repair accessible to all, regardless of income since 2003. What was once a small-scale workshop in a storage unit is now a state-wide network of five brick and mortar shops (in Salt Lake City, Ogden, Provo, St. George) that repair and distribute donated bikes by the thousands each year.
